Job Description

What youll do

As a Technical Accounting Manager you will work closely with the Senior Director Technical Accounting in addressing technical accounting issues including revenue recognition inventory long-lived assets transaction structuring accounting for treasury real estate and restructuring transactions adoption of new standards acquisition accounting due diligence and support of finance operations in application of US GAAP. In addition you will assist in the following areas:

Controllership:

Assist in developing/deploying training materials for field finance teams

Assist in drafting quarterly newsletter for world-wide finance team and coordinate distribution

Assist in responding to questions relating to Approval Authority Matrix

Coordinate distribution of and assist in reviewing representation letters

Demonstrate expertise in US GAAP by:

Gathering facts from field inquiries regarding application of US GAAP

Tracking field inquiries to help identify clarifications to accounting policies and emerging business issues

Assisting with the opening balance sheet relating to any M&A activity

Drafting appropriate memoranda where necessary

Proactively researching accounting for potential unique events conditions and types of transactions

Assisting with analysis and implementation of new accounting pronouncements

Support external reporting efforts including:

Balance sheet account analysis during quarterly close

Compliance with Government reporting requirements

Drafting new disclosures

Develop credibility and collaborative relationships with peers and upper management by:

Periodically visiting operating sites and delivering training

Investing time to understand Thermo Fishers business and industries through collaboration on ad hoc projects with cross-functional teams including FP&A Treasury Real Estate Operations and Legal.

How youll get here

Bachelors degree in Accounting and Certified Public Accountant (current active or inactive license)

5 years of accounting experience including 4 years of Big 4 accounting firm experience (preferably working with public companies in life sciences or technology)

In-depth understanding of US GAAP

Familiarity with SEC reporting and internal controls over financial reporting

Strong project management skills

Experienced with complex global companies preferred

Excel expertise with advanced knowledge of pivots charts and formulas

Self-motivated higher level of flexibility and strong work ethic with the goal to get the job done

Excellent spoken and written communication skills are required to collaborate with various partners

Experience with Hyperion or other financial databases preferred
